Detailed analysis of cosmic ray composition during the solar flare on
the 29 of April 1973 led to the conclusion that there was a flux of
solar electrons with energy Ee > 100 MeV in the flare. The
energy spectrum of the electrons was obtained up to the energy
Ee ≡ 1 GeV.
